This newly built house is on a new estate to the south west of Dublin in the Citywest area is only 17 minutes away by car.
Internally the house is airtigiht due to the Insulated Concrete Framework construction method leading to far better heat and energy efficiency and meeting theNearly Zero Energy Building (nZEB) standards. Downstairs there is a full lenght kitchen diner with a separate living room on the other side of the entrance hall. Upstairs there are four moderate sized bedrooms with a bathroom and ensuite to the master bedroom. The location is well placed for the city as well as local shops and schools as well as the motorway and airport.
The competition is being run by an Irish football club in the same format as multiple other Irish house competitions, this is a highly successful approach which nearly always results in the house being given to a lucky competition winner. Note that the winner is liable for taxes and legal fees in order to take possession of the property. There are also other prizes available to runners up including a car and a holiday.
Competition Outcome
Winning Prize: PropertyTickets Sold: 15,000
The competition tickets sold out in late November, the draw took place early December. A man named John Anthony was the winner and was handed the keys to his new house in a ceremony later in December.
